Before moving back to Vermont a few years ago and becoming the bass player in The New Year , Mike Donofrio released five albums and toured the US repeatedly with his NYC indie rock band Saturnine . This year marked the end of Saturnine with the release of their final album Things of Remembrance Past . The album is a conceptual rock opera based upon the work of Marcel Proust. Here is Part II: Macha multi-instrumentalist brother's Josh and Mischo McKay and Bedhead's guitar songwriting siblings Matt and Bubba Kadane grew up together in Wichita, Texas .
